Man charged with series of offences in Hastings

Wednesday, 21 January 2026 11:07

By V2 RADIO X @V2RadioSussex

A man has been charged with kidnap, aggravated vehicle taking and dangerous driving following a collision in Hastings.

Alfie Foster, 22, of Crowborough Road, Hastings, is also charged with intentional strangulation, and assault on a woman known to him and theft from a dwelling. 

Officers were called about 12.27am on Sunday 18 January after a car collided with railings in St Helen’s Road.

The passenger – a 23-year-old local woman – was taken to hospital with serious but not life-threatening injuries, while the driver left the scene. He was arrested after being located at a nearby address.

Foster has been remanded to appear at Brighton Magistrates’ Court on Wednesday 21 January.
